Aberdeen murder trial hears closing speeches
- Published
Closing speeches have been heard in the trial of a man accused of raping and murdering a woman in an Aberdeen city centre flat.
Bala Chinda, 26, is alleged to have killed 36-year-old escort Nkechi McGraa - also known as Jessica - at a flat in Union Terrace in February 2016.
Advocate Depute Paul Kearney said there was overwhelming evidence against him.
However, defence counsel Ian Duguid said the prosecution had not proved guilt of rape and murder.
The trial, at the High Court in Aberdeen, continues on Thursday.
